Essential SEO Techniques for Web Developers

0
16

Essential SEO Techniques for Web Developers

In today’s digital world, having a well-optimized website is crucial for online success. Search Engine Optimization (SEO) plays a vital role in improving a website’s visibility and driving organic traffic. As a web developer, it is essential to understand and incorporate SEO techniques during the development process to ensure maximum exposure and achieve desired results. In this article, we will explore some of the essential SEO techniques that every web developer should be familiar with.

1. Proper Website Structure and Navigation:
A well-structured website with clear navigation helps search engines understand the content hierarchy and user experience. It is important to create a logical and intuitive website structure, allowing easy access to all pages. Implementing breadcrumbs, descriptive URLs, and a user-friendly navigation menu are effective ways to improve the accessibility of your website for both search engines and users.

2. Optimized Page Titles and Meta Descriptions:
Page titles and meta descriptions are HTML elements that define a webpage’s title and brief description in search engine results. They play a crucial role in attracting users to click through to your website. Web developers should ensure that each page has a unique and descriptive title and meta description that effectively communicates the page’s content and target keywords. Keeping them within the recommended character limits (around 60 characters for titles and 160 characters for descriptions) is crucial for better visibility in search results.

3. Responsive and Mobile-Friendly Design:
Mobile devices account for a significant portion of web traffic today. Therefore, it is essential to create websites that are responsive and mobile-friendly. Search engines, like Google, prioritize mobile-friendly websites for improved user experience. Web developers must ensure that their website is optimized for various screen sizes, loads quickly on mobile devices, and has a mobile-friendly layout to provide seamless access to all users.

4. Fast Page Loading Speed:
Page loading speed is a critical factor in user experience and SEO. Slow-loading websites can frustrate users and reduce engagement. Search engines also consider page loading speed as a ranking factor. Web developers should implement techniques such as optimizing image sizes, minifying CSS and JavaScript files, enabling browser caching, and using Content Delivery Networks (CDNs) to improve the overall speed and performance of the website.

5. Image Optimization:
Images are essential for enhancing user experience and conveying information. However, they can significantly impact a website’s loading speed if not optimized correctly. Web developers should optimize images by compressing them without losing quality, using appropriate formats (JPEG for photographs, PNG for transparent images), and adding relevant alt tags to provide context to search engines and visually impaired users.

6. Implementing Structured Data Markup:
Structured data markup refers to a standardized format used to provide additional context about the content on a webpage to search engines. By implementing structured data using schemas like JSON-LD or microdata, web developers can improve the website’s chances of having rich snippets displayed in search results. Rich snippets enhance visibility and provide more detailed information, such as star ratings, reviews, or event details, directly in the search results.

7. SEO-Friendly URL Structure:
Having SEO-friendly URLs not only helps search engines understand the context of your webpages but also aids users in remembering and sharing the web addresses. Web developers should create URLs that are concise, descriptive, and contain relevant keywords. Avoid excessive use of numbers, symbols, or random characters; instead, use hyphens to separate words for improved readability.

8. Secure HTTPS Connection:
Having a secure HTTPS connection is not only essential for user privacy and data security but also benefits SEO. Search engines prioritize websites with SSL certificates and HTTPS connections, as they provide a secure browsing experience. Web developers should ensure that their websites utilize SSL certificates to encrypt data transmission and provide a safe environment for users.

9. Implementing XML Sitemaps:
XML sitemaps play a crucial role in helping search engines understand the structure and content of your website. By creating and submitting an XML sitemap to search engines, web developers can ensure that search engine bots can efficiently crawl and index all the important pages of a website. This improves the website’s visibility and chances of being ranked higher in search results.

10. Regular Monitoring and Analysis:
SEO is an ongoing process, and continuous monitoring and analysis are critical for success. Web developers should regularly monitor website performance through tools like Google Analytics, Google Search Console, or third-party SEO software. Analyzing data related to organic traffic, user behavior, page load speed, and keyword rankings can help identify areas for improvement and make data-driven decisions to optimize the website further.

In conclusion, incorporating essential SEO techniques during the web development process is crucial for creating well-optimized websites with maximum visibility in search engine results. Following the above techniques can improve a website’s accessibility, usability, and search engine rankings, ultimately leading to increased organic traffic and online success. As a web developer, staying updated with the latest SEO trends and best practices is essential to deliver outstanding results and exceed client expectations.